the dog days of summer...

I've always wondered what this phrase meant, since the dog days are not at all suitable for dogs, so I googled it, and learned that it has to do the constellations, namely Sirius (not satellite radio and not the animagus from Harry Potter), but Sirius, the dog star.

Webster's dictionary defines it as- 1: the period between early July and early September when the hot sultry weather of summer usually occurs in the northern hemisphere; 2: a period of stagnation or inactivity
